< prev index next >
src/hotspot/cpu/x86/assembler_x86.hpp
Print this page
@@ -1666,10 +1666,16 @@
void vpmovzxwd(XMMRegister dst, XMMRegister src, int vector_len);
void evpmovdb(Address dst, XMMRegister src, int vector_len);
+ // Multiply add
+ void pmaddwd(XMMRegister dst, XMMRegister src);
+ void vpmaddwd(XMMRegister dst, XMMRegister nds, XMMRegister src, int vector_len);
+ // Multiply add accumulate
+ void evpdpwssd(XMMRegister dst, XMMRegister nds, XMMRegister src, int vector_len);
+
#ifndef _LP64 // no 32bit push/pop on amd64
void popl(Address dst);
#endif
#ifdef _LP64
< prev index next >